Window remodeling services involve upgrading or replacing existing windows to improve the appearance, functionality, and efficiency of a property. This process may include installing new window frames, upgrading glass panes, or changing window styles to better suit the architectural design of a building. Contractors typically assess the current windows to determine the best options for enhancing energy efficiency, security, and aesthetic appeal. The goal is to provide a solution that aligns with the property owner’s needs while ensuring the installation is performed with attention to detail and quality.

These services help address common iss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and outdated designs that no longer match the property's style. Replacing or refurbishing windows can also reduce energy costs by improving insulation, preventing heat loss during colder months and keeping interiors cooler in warmer weather. Additionally, window remodeling can enhance security by installing more durable materials and modern locking mechanisms. For properties experiencing water leaks or condensation between panes, window replacement can resolve these problems effectively.

The overview below groups typical Window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glenshaw,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, a standard double-pane window in Glenshaw might cost around $500 installed. Prices can vary based on the complexity of the installation and window type.

Labor Expenses - Labor fees for window remodeling services gener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. This range covers removal of old windows and installation of new ones by local contractors. Costs may increase for custom or larger window projects.

Material Prices - The price of window materials can vary from $150 to $800 per window. V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, while wood or fiberglass options are usually at the higher end of the spectrum. Material choice influences the overall project cost.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as framing, insulation, or window treatments can add $50 to $200 per window. These costs depend on the condition of existing openings and the desired finish.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ing old windows? Replacing outdated wind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, and increase indoor comfort by reducing drafts and heat transfer.

How long does a window remodeling project typically take? The duration varies depending on the scope of work and property size,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project details.

What types of windows are available for remodeling? There are various options including double-hung, casement, picture, and specialty windows, allowing for customization to match style and function preferences.

Can window remodeling help with energy savings? Yes, installing modern, energy-efficient windows can reduce heating and cooling costs by improving insulation and sealing leaks.
